James Harden hits clutch three to win it vs. Suns

One of the NBA’s most prolific scorers, James Harden, came up clutch when it mattered most, and the Brooklyn Nets teammates Kevin Durant and Kyrie Irving were loving it.

Brooklyn came back from a 24-point deficit to win vs. the Phoenix Suns (Final score 128-124). The Nets played without Durant and Irving.

Harden took the team’s leadership and had 38 points (14-22 FG, 5-11 3Pt, 5-5 FT), 11 assists, and 7 rebounds in 37 minutes.

James Harden Hits Clutch Three To Cap Off 24-PT Comeback Win Against Suns

The Nets trailed by 21 points at halftime of tonight’s victory over Phoenix, marking the largest halftime comeback for the Nets since joining the NBA in 1976.
